| | | |
Offset 56, 99 lines modified | Offset 56, 14 lines modified |
56 | ····iput·p7,·p0,·Landroidx/navigation/NavOptions;->mPopExitAnim:I | 56 | ····iput·p7,·p0,·Landroidx/navigation/NavOptions;->mPopExitAnim:I |
| |
57 | ····return-void | 57 | ····return-void |
58 | .end·method | 58 | .end·method |
| |
| |
59 | #·virtual·methods | 59 | #·virtual·methods |
60 | .method·public·equals(Ljava/lang/Object;)Z | |
61 | ····.locals·4 | |
| |
62 | ····const/4·v0,·0x1 | |
| |
63 | ····if-ne·p0,·p1,·:cond_0 | |
| |
64 | ····return·v0 | |
| |
65 | ····:cond_0 | |
66 | ····const/4·v1,·0x0 | |
| |
67 | ····if-eqz·p1,·:cond_3 | |
| |
68 | ····.line·126 | |
69 | ····const-class·v2,·Landroidx/navigation/NavOptions; | |
| |
70 | ····invoke-virtual·{p1},·Ljava/lang/Object;->getClass()Ljava/lang/Class; | |
| |
71 | ····move-result-object·v3 | |
| |
72 | ····if-eq·v2,·v3,·:cond_1 | |
| |
73 | ····goto·:goto_1 | |
| |
74 | ····.line·127 | |
75 | ····:cond_1 | |
76 | ····check-cast·p1,·Landroidx/navigation/NavOptions; | |
| |
77 | ····.line·128 | |
78 | ····iget-boolean·v2,·p0,·Landroidx/navigation/NavOptions;->mSingleTop:Z | |
| |
79 | ····iget-boolean·v3,·p1,·Landroidx/navigation/NavOptions;->mSingleTop:Z | |
| |
80 | ····if-ne·v2,·v3,·:cond_2 | |
| |
81 | ····iget·v2,·p0,·Landroidx/navigation/NavOptions;->mPopUpTo:I | |
| |
82 | ····iget·v3,·p1,·Landroidx/navigation/NavOptions;->mPopUpTo:I | |
| |
83 | ····if-ne·v2,·v3,·:cond_2 | |
| |
84 | ····iget-boolean·v2,·p0,·Landroidx/navigation/NavOptions;->mPopUpToInclusive:Z | |
| |
85 | ····iget-boolean·v3,·p1,·Landroidx/navigation/NavOptions;->mPopUpToInclusive:Z | |
| |
86 | ····if-ne·v2,·v3,·:cond_2 | |
| |
87 | ····iget·v2,·p0,·Landroidx/navigation/NavOptions;->mEnterAnim:I | |
| |
88 | ····iget·v3,·p1,·Landroidx/navigation/NavOptions;->mEnterAnim:I | |
| |
89 | ····if-ne·v2,·v3,·:cond_2 | |
| |
90 | ····iget·v2,·p0,·Landroidx/navigation/NavOptions;->mExitAnim:I | |
| |
91 | ····iget·v3,·p1,·Landroidx/navigation/NavOptions;->mExitAnim:I | |
| |
92 | ····if-ne·v2,·v3,·:cond_2 | |
| |
93 | ····iget·v2,·p0,·Landroidx/navigation/NavOptions;->mPopEnterAnim:I | |
| |
94 | ····iget·v3,·p1,·Landroidx/navigation/NavOptions;->mPopEnterAnim:I | |
| |
95 | ····if-ne·v2,·v3,·:cond_2 | |
| |
96 | ····iget·v2,·p0,·Landroidx/navigation/NavOptions;->mPopExitAnim:I | |
| |
97 | ····iget·p1,·p1,·Landroidx/navigation/NavOptions;->mPopExitAnim:I | |
| |
98 | ····if-ne·v2,·p1,·:cond_2 | |
| |
99 | ····goto·:goto_0 | |
| |
100 | ····:cond_2 | |
101 | ····move·v0,·v1 | |
| |
102 | ····:goto_0 | |
103 | ····return·v0 | |
| |
104 | ····:cond_3 | |
105 | ····:goto_1 | |
106 | ····return·v1 | |
107 | .end·method | |
| |
108 | .method·public·getEnterAnim()I | 60 | .method·public·getEnterAnim()I |
109 | ····.locals·1 | 61 | ····.locals·1 |
| |
110 | ····.line·91 | 62 | ····.line·91 |
111 | ····iget·v0,·p0,·Landroidx/navigation/NavOptions;->mEnterAnim:I | 63 | ····iget·v0,·p0,·Landroidx/navigation/NavOptions;->mEnterAnim:I |
| |
112 | ····return·v0 | 64 | ····return·v0 |
Offset 186, 79 lines modified | Offset 101, 14 lines modified |
| |
186 | ····.line·73 | 101 | ····.line·73 |
187 | ····iget·v0,·p0,·Landroidx/navigation/NavOptions;->mPopUpTo:I | 102 | ····iget·v0,·p0,·Landroidx/navigation/NavOptions;->mPopUpTo:I |
| |
188 | ····return·v0 | 103 | ····return·v0 |
189 | .end·method | 104 | .end·method |
| |
190 | .method·public·hashCode()I | |
191 | ····.locals·2 | |
| |
192 | ····.line·139 | |
193 | ····invoke-virtual·{p0},·Landroidx/navigation/NavOptions;->shouldLaunchSingleTop()Z | |
| |
194 | ····move-result·v0 | |
| |
195 | ····mul-int/lit8·v0,·v0,·0x1f | |
| |
196 | ····.line·140 | |
197 | ····invoke-virtual·{p0},·Landroidx/navigation/NavOptions;->getPopUpTo()I | |
| |
198 | ····move-result·v1 | |
| |
199 | ····add-int/2addr·v0,·v1 | |
| |
200 | ····mul-int/lit8·v0,·v0,·0x1f | |
| |
201 | ····.line·141 | |
202 | ····invoke-virtual·{p0},·Landroidx/navigation/NavOptions;->isPopUpToInclusive()Z | |
| |
203 | ····move-result·v1 | |
| |
204 | ····add-int/2addr·v0,·v1 | |
| |
205 | ····mul-int/lit8·v0,·v0,·0x1f | |
| |
206 | ····.line·142 | |
207 | ····invoke-virtual·{p0},·Landroidx/navigation/NavOptions;->getEnterAnim()I | |
| |
208 | ····move-result·v1 | |
| |
209 | ····add-int/2addr·v0,·v1 | |
| |
210 | ····mul-int/lit8·v0,·v0,·0x1f | |
| |
211 | ····.line·143 | |
212 | ····invoke-virtual·{p0},·Landroidx/navigation/NavOptions;->getExitAnim()I | |
| |
213 | ····move-result·v1 | |
| |
214 | ····add-int/2addr·v0,·v1 | |
| |
215 | ····mul-int/lit8·v0,·v0,·0x1f | |
| |
216 | ····.line·144 | |
217 | ····invoke-virtual·{p0},·Landroidx/navigation/NavOptions;->getPopEnterAnim()I | |
| |
218 | ····move-result·v1 | |
| |
219 | ····add-int/2addr·v0,·v1 | |
| |
220 | ····mul-int/lit8·v0,·v0,·0x1f | |
| |
221 | ····.line·145 | |
222 | ····invoke-virtual·{p0},·Landroidx/navigation/NavOptions;->getPopExitAnim()I | |
| |
223 | ····move-result·v1 | |
| |
224 | ····add-int/2addr·v0,·v1 | |
| |
225 | ····return·v0 | |
226 | .end·method | |
| |
227 | .method·public·isPopUpToInclusive()Z | 105 | .method·public·isPopUpToInclusive()Z |
228 | ····.locals·1 | 106 | ····.locals·1 |
| |
229 | ····.line·82 | 107 | ····.line·82 |
230 | ····iget-boolean·v0,·p0,·Landroidx/navigation/NavOptions;->mPopUpToInclusive:Z | 108 | ····iget-boolean·v0,·p0,·Landroidx/navigation/NavOptions;->mPopUpToInclusive:Z |
| |
231 | ····return·v0 | 109 | ····return·v0 |